Representative Sonia Galaviz’s RS 32-458, a cleanup to restore districts’ staff‑allowance flexibility by removing statutory restrictions added in 2016, was approved for printing after committee discussion. Sponsors said state Department of Education reporting remains intact.

Representative Sonia Galaviz (D‑District 16) presented RS 32-458 to the House Education Committee, describing the measure as a cleanup to remove a statutory provision that reduced districts’ flexibility to use staffing allocations.
